package android.graphics;
import android.content.res.AssetManager;
import android.util.SparseArray;
import java.io.File;
/**
* The Typeface class specifies the typeface and intrinsic style of a font.
* This is used in the paint, along with optionally Paint settings like
* textSize, textSkewX, textScaleX to specify
* how text appears when drawn (and measured).
*/
public class Typeface {
/** The default NORMAL typeface object */
public static final Typeface DEFAULT;
/**
* The default BOLD typeface object. Note: this may be not actually be
* bold, depending on what fonts are installed. Call getStyle() to know
* for sure.
*/
public static final Typeface DEFAULT_BOLD;
/** The NORMAL style of the default sans serif typeface. */
public static final Typeface SANS_SERIF;
/** The NORMAL style of the default serif typeface. */
public static final Typeface SERIF;
/** The NORMAL style of the default monospace typeface. */
public static final Typeface MONOSPACE;
static Typeface[] sDefaults;
private static final SparseArray<SparseArray<Typeface>> sTypefaceCache =
new SparseArray<SparseArray<Typeface>>(3);
int native_instance;
// Style
public static final int NORMAL = 0;
public static final int BOLD = 1;
public static final int ITALIC = 2;
public static final int BOLD_ITALIC = 3;
private int mStyle = 0;
/** Returns the typeface's intrinsic style attributes */
public int getStyle() {
return mStyle;
}
/** Returns true if getStyle() has the BOLD bit set. */
public final boolean isBold() {
return (mStyle & BOLD) != 0;
}
/** Returns true if getStyle() has the ITALIC bit set. */
public final boolean isItalic() {
return (mStyle & ITALIC) != 0;
}
/**
* Create a typeface object given a family name, and option style information.
* If null is passed for the name, then the "default" font will be chosen.
* The resulting typeface object can be queried (getStyle()) to discover what
* its "real" style characteristics are.
*
* @param familyName May be null. The name of the font family.
* @param style The style (normal, bold, italic) of the typeface.
* e.g. NORMAL, BOLD, ITALIC, BOLD_ITALIC
* @return The best matching typeface.
*/
public static Typeface create(String familyName, int style) {
return new Typeface(nativeCreate(familyName, style));
}
/**
* Create a typeface object that best matches the specified existing
* typeface and the specified Style. Use this call if you want to pick a new
* style from the same family of an existing typeface object. If family is
* null, this selects from the default font's family.
*
* @param family May be null. The name of the existing type face.
* @param style The style (normal, bold, italic) of the typeface.
* e.g. NORMAL, BOLD, ITALIC, BOLD_ITALIC
* @return The best matching typeface.
*/
public static Typeface create(Typeface family, int style) {
int ni = 0;
if (family != null) {
// Return early if we're asked for the same face/style
if (family.mStyle == style) {
return family;
}
ni = family.native_instance;
}
Typeface typeface;
SparseArray<Typeface> styles = sTypefaceCache.get(ni);
if (styles != null) {
typeface = styles.get(style);
if (typeface != null) {
return typeface;
}
}
typeface = new Typeface(nativeCreateFromTypeface(ni, style));
if (styles == null) {
styles = new SparseArray<Typeface>(4);
sTypefaceCache.put(ni, styles);
}
styles.put(style, typeface);
return typeface;
}
/**
* Returns one of the default typeface objects, based on the specified style
*
* @return the default typeface that corresponds to the style
*/
public static Typeface defaultFromStyle(int style) {
return sDefaults[style];
}
/**
* Create a new typeface from the specified font data.
* @param mgr The application's asset manager
* @param path The file name of the font data in the assets directory
* @return The new typeface.
*/
public static Typeface createFromAsset(AssetManager mgr, String path) {
return new Typeface(nativeCreateFromAsset(mgr, path));
}
/**
* Create a new typeface from the specified font file.
*
* @param path The path to the font data.
* @return The new typeface.
*/
public static Typeface createFromFile(File path) {
return new Typeface(nativeCreateFromFile(path.getAbsolutePath()));
}
/**
* Create a new typeface from the specified font file.
*
* @param path The full path to the font data.
* @return The new typeface.
*/
public static Typeface createFromFile(String path) {
return new Typeface(nativeCreateFromFile(path));
}
// don't allow clients to call this directly
private Typeface(int ni) {
if (ni == 0) {
throw new RuntimeException("native typeface cannot be made");
}
native_instance = ni;
mStyle = nativeGetStyle(ni);
}
static {
DEFAULT = create((String) null, 0);
DEFAULT_BOLD = create((String) null, Typeface.BOLD);
SANS_SERIF = create("sans-serif", 0);
SERIF = create("serif", 0);
MONOSPACE = create("monospace", 0);
sDefaults = new Typeface[] {
DEFAULT,
DEFAULT_BOLD,
create((String) null, Typeface.ITALIC),
create((String) null, Typeface.BOLD_ITALIC),
};
}
protected void finalize() throws Throwable {
try {
nativeUnref(native_instance);
} finally {
super.finalize();
}
}
@Override
public boolean equals(Object o) {
if (this == o) return true;
if (o == null || getClass() != o.getClass()) return false;
Typeface typeface = (Typeface) o;
return mStyle == typeface.mStyle && native_instance == typeface.native_instance;
}
@Override
public int hashCode() {
int result = native_instance;
result = 31 * result + mStyle;
return result;
}
private static native int nativeCreate(String familyName, int style);
private static native int nativeCreateFromTypeface(int native_instance, int style);
private static native void nativeUnref(int native_instance);
private static native int nativeGetStyle(int native_instance);
private static native int nativeCreateFromAsset(AssetManager mgr, String path);
private static native int nativeCreateFromFile(String path);
}
